Sunday, september 30, 2018: the historical buddha is often described as belonging to the indian renouncer tradition. What kinds of activities is a renouncer engaged in? (pg. The renouncer abandons conventional means of livelihood, such as farming or trade, and adopts the religious life as a means of livelihood. Three kinds of activities they participated in: practice of austerities, going naked in all weather, enduring, all physical discomforts, fasting, or undertaking the vow to live like a cow or a dog. Second, there is the cultivation of meditative and contemplative techniques referred to as altered states of consciousness, doing so in order to get deeper knowledge and experience of the nature of the world.
